M+S Hydraulic AD (5MH BU) reported a net loss of BGN 0.4m for 2Q09 due to sharply lower sales (-61.7% y/y) and higher depreciation charges (+21.4% y/y), which were partially offset by lower material (-70.5% y/y) and labour costs (-52.1% y/y). The firm’s EBITDA margin increased to 15.1% in 2Q09 from 13.9% in 2Q08 due to a sharp reduction in material and labour costs. M+S Hydraulic is one of the world’s leading manufacturers of hydraulic motors and steering units. Our view: We expect the firm’s sales to deteriorate sharply in 2009 due to a dramatic deceleration in global demand for hydraulic units. The company’s sales could also be adversely affected by a weak US dollar, which will benefit US competitors. In view of the falling demand, the firm’s management intends to cut its headcount by up to 20% in 2009.
